Striking Citroen C4 Cactus Aventure concept revealed

A more extreme version of the Citroen C4 Cactus, called the Aventure concept, has been showcased at Geneva

This is the Citroen C4 Cactus Aventure concept. It’s a striking, off-road-inspired interpretation of the recently revealed C4 Cactus, and it has just debuted at the Geneva Motor Show alongside the standard model on which it is based.

Changes for this new concept include raised suspension and extended wheel arches, which will help accommodate the bulkier off-road tyres. Citroen has also given the Aventure concept a metal bullbar at the front, covered in protective padding. A bespoke roofbox complete with built-in spotlights has also been added.

If the addition of all the off-road goodies weren’t enough, Citroen has also decorated the Aventure concept in a striking white and yellow paintjob, with matching camouflage decals.

However, the concept is likely to remain just that - there is no indication that the Aventure concept will be put into production.

The standard C4 Cactus will make it to showrooms, however. The model has set the template for future C-line Citroens, which will offer increased space and practicality but with significantly reduced running costs thanks to clever packaging and weight reduction.
